Discover the grape variety: Pinot noir

Elegant reds, light in colour with silky tannins, showing strawberry, cherry and raspberry aromas, evolving to forest floor, mushroom and spice with age. Fresh acidity, delicate finish. Star of the Côte d'Or (Romanée-Conti, Chambertin, Volnay), pillar of Champagne (Blanc de Noirs) and signature of Oregon, Central Otago and Sonoma Coast. An early-ripening Burgundian variety, one of the world's greatest.

The wine region of Aconcagua Costa

Chilean sub-region of Aconcagua Valley near the Pacific, cool climate shaped by the Humboldt Current, schist and granite soils, emerging zone (~2005) pioneering cool-climate winemaking (Errazuriz flagship). Sauvignon Blanc: vivid and taut with citrus, grapefruit, cut grass, white flowers and a saline-mineral edge, razor-sharp acidity. Chardonnay: broad and upright. Pinot Noir: airy and elegant.


The wine region of Aconcagua

Chilean valley at the foot of the highest summit of the Americas (6,960 m), hot dry climate tempered by Pacific breezes, altitude vineyards up to 1,600 m. Signature Cabernet Sauvignon as red king: powerful with blackcurrant, blackberry, black cherry, eucalyptus, cedar, tobacco and peppery touch, firm tannins and exceptional ageing — home of Errazuriz (1870) and great Chileans (Sena, Don Maximiano). Dense Syrah, spiced Carmenere and supple Merlot as complements.

The word of the wine: Ample

Said of a generous wine with a rich body that gives an impression of fullness in the mouth.
